What is the Home Institution Approval Form?
The Home Institution Approval Form is a crucial document required for students planning to study abroad. This form serves as a formal request for approval from the student's home institution, ensuring that the study abroad program aligns with their academic objectives. Issued by CET Academic Programs, this form plays a significant role in the study abroad application process, helping students secure necessary approvals for their overseas studies.

Who Needs the Home Institution Approval Form?
The Home Institution Approval Form is necessary for both undergraduate and graduate students planning to enroll in study abroad programs. Typically, students must fill out this form with their study abroad advisors or relevant professionals who can validate their academic plans.
Scenarios where this form is crucial include applications for semester-long study programs, short-term faculty-led trips, or internships abroad, where institutions require confirmation of credit transfers and alignment with academic standards.

Who is eligible to use the Home Institution Approval Form?
The Home Institution Approval Form is intended for undergraduate and graduate students who are applying to study abroad programs through CET Academic Programs.
What is the submission method for the Home Institution Approval Form?
Completed forms should be returned to CET via post, fax, or email. Ensure to double-check the submission guidelines that come with the form.
